Table des matières
- 1 Comment fonctionne la programmation modulaire?
- 2 Qu’est-ce que la programmation orientée objet?
- 3 Quels sont les paradigmes en programmation?
- 4 Comment apprendre la programmation pour les enfants?
- 5 Quels sont les bénéfices de la programmation informatique?
- 6 Comment est apparu le terme de programmation?
- 7 Comment lier le programme avec la librairie mathématique?
Comment fonctionne la programmation modulaire?
La programmation modulaire n’implique pas l’usage d’un style de ou d’un paradigme de programmation particulier ; les éléments qu’elle structure peuvent être de style objet, impératif ou fonctionnel. L’opposée de la programmation modulaire est le raffinement.
Quelle est l’hypothèse de la modularité?
Dans les domaines de la psychologie et de la neuropsychologie cognitives, l’hypothèse de la modularité conduit à envisager la vie mentale comme une réalité sous-tendue par le fonctionnement coordonné d’un ensemble de processeurs cognitifs spécialisés (ou modules ).
Qu’est-ce que la programmation orientée objet?
Qu’est-ce que la programmation orientée objet? On peut souvent entendre dire qu’un langage de programmation orienté object Python apporte de grands avantages de la modularité, l’abstraction, la productivité et ré-utilisabilité, la sûreté… Python en est lui même un, d’ailleurs une des raisons pour lesquelles il est aussi populaire.
Est-ce que l’organisation cérébrale serait modulaire?
Ainsi, l’organisation cérébrale serait elle-même modulaire. Cette mise en relation entre modules cognitifs et structures cérébrales spécifiques permet de rendre compte du fait qu’une lésion cérébrale focalisée est susceptible de déterminer la perte d’une capacité cognitive particulière sans que les autres capacités en soient altérées.
Quels sont les paradigmes en programmation?
Les paradigmes en programmation désignent les principes fondamentaux du développement de logiciels. Au mieux, on peut se les représenter comme des styles de programmation fondamentaux divers générant des codes logiciels de structure différente. Traditionnellement, la programmation impérative est la forme la plus courante.
Comment fonctionne la programmation générique?
De plus, suivant les langages de programmation, les modules peuvent être paramétrés et/ou polymorphes ( foncteur) ce qui apporte une modularité dont la souplesse décuplée amène alors à parler de généricité . La programmation générique est un sur-ensemble qui peut tirer avantageusement parti de la modularité apportée par la programmation modulaire.
Comment apprendre la programmation pour les enfants?
Apprendre la programmation est très divertissant pour les enfants si elle leur est enseignée d’une façon adaptée à leur âge. À travers des langages de programmation graphiques, des processus intuitifs et des projets captivants, ils en apprennent les bases et peuvent élargir ces connaissances en augmentant la difficulté.
Quels sont les bénéfices de la programmation?
Au delà de l’apprentissage du langage informatique, les bénéfices de la programmation sont nombreux car elle permet de développer beaucoup de capacités. Notre but n’est pas de former de futurs informaticiens. Les écoles de musique ne forment pas de futurs musiciens professionnels.
Quels sont les bénéfices de la programmation informatique?
C’est la même chose pour les bénéfices de la programmation informatique : son enseignement place les enfants dans une situation active qui nourrit leur curiosité et développe principalement trois capacités: L’enfant qui programme doit sans cesse réfléchir à ce qu’il doit faire en premier.
La programmation modulaire n’implique pas l’usage d’un style de ou d’un paradigme de programmation particulier ; les éléments qu’elle structure peuvent être de style objet, impératif ou fonctionnel. L’opposée de la programmation modulaire est le raffinement.
Quelle est la différence entre programmation procédurale et programmation orientée objet?
La différence clé entre programmation procédurale et programmation orientée objet (POO) réside dans le fait que dans la programmation procédurale, les programmes sont exécutés avec des fonctions, et les données peuvent être facilement accessibles et modifiables, alors qu’en programmation orientée objet, chaque programme est constitué d’entités
De plus, suivant les langages de programmation, les modules peuvent être paramétrés et/ou polymorphes ( foncteur) ce qui apporte une modularité dont la souplesse décuplée amène alors à parler de généricité . La programmation générique est un sur-ensemble qui peut tirer avantageusement parti de la modularité apportée par la programmation modulaire.
Qu’est-ce que la programmation orientée objet? On peut souvent entendre dire qu’un langage de programmation orienté object Python apporte de grands avantages de la modularité, l’abstraction, la productivité et ré-utilisabilité, la sûreté… Python en est lui même un, d’ailleurs une des raisons pour lesquelles il est aussi populaire.
Comment est apparu le terme de programmation?
Le terme de programmation est apparu avant que les premiers ordinateurs ne voient le jour, grâce à de célèbres théoriciens de l’informatique, Ada Lovelace (1815-1852), Charles Babbage (1791-1871) et Alan Turing (1912-1954) (plus de renseignements en bas de l’article avec des liens vers des vidéos et des autres articles).
Quels sont les composants d un programme en langage C?
Un programme en langage C est constitu des six groupes de composants l mentaires suivants : les identificateurs, les mots-clefs, les constantes, les cha nes de caract res, les op rateurs, les signes de ponctuation.
Comment lier le programme avec la librairie mathématique?
Par exemple, pour lier le programme avec la librairie mathématique, on spécifie -lm. Le fichier objet correspondant est libm.a. Lorsque les librairies pré-compilées ne se trouvent pas dans le répertoire usuel, on spécifie leur chemin d’accès par l’option -L.